Success in action: Dawn Zu Zu Yar Khaing’s story


In January 2025, Daw Zu Zu Yar Khine, a farmer from Myit Tan Village within Bogalay Township, discovered about Black Soldier Fly (BSF) farming through training provided by Kyal Sin May Organization, which received technical assistance from Spectrum.
By utilizing BSF larvae as feed for her chickens, she observed their weight increase from 12 to 35 ticals in just one month. Although she faced initial difficulties with overcrowded trays, she modified her techniques and successfully stabilized her production.
Eventually, she sold 9 kg of larvae for breeding purposes, earning more than 100,000 MMK and sparking interest among her fellow villagers. Daw Zu Zu Yar Khine now intends to expand her BSF operation, use the waste as organic fertilizer for her crops, and manufacture solid animal feed—demonstrating a viable model of sustainable agriculture, income generation, and waste recycling.
